Foxtable(狐表)用户栏目专家坐堂 → (求助)这个表达式怎么写


  共有13385人关注过本帖树形打印复制链接

主题:(求助)这个表达式怎么写

帅哥哟,离线,有人找我吗?
jjyou
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:18 积分:312 威望:0 精华:0 注册:2010/3/6 17:00:00
(求助)这个表达式怎么写  发帖心情 Post By:2010/3/20 13:20:00 [只看该作者]

在表C中有A、B两列,B的值取决于A列的值,请帮助解决
A列为空,B列为空
[A列]= 0,[B列]=1
0<[A列]<= 5,[B列]=INT([A列]/0.5)*0.01+1
5<[A列]<= 8,[B列]=INT(([A列]-5)/0.5)*0.02+1.1
8<[A列]<= 10,[B列]=INT(([A列]-8)/0.5)*0.03+1.22

 回到顶部
帅哥哟,离线,有人找我吗?
lxl
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信 一级勋章
等级:MVP荣誉狐 帖子:858 积分:6071 威望:0 精华:19 注册:2008/9/1 9:13:00
  发帖心情 Post By:2010/3/20 13:33:00 [只看该作者]

A列只有整数吗
大于10的时候B列又是多少?

 回到顶部
帅哥哟,离线,有人找我吗?
lxl
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信 一级勋章
等级:MVP荣誉狐 帖子:858 积分:6071 威望:0 精华:19 注册:2008/9/1 9:13:00
  发帖心情 Post By:2010/3/20 13:49:00 [只看该作者]

IIF([A] Is Null Or [A] < 0 Or [A] > 10,Null,IIF([A] = 0,1,IIF([A]<=5,Convert([A]*2,System.Int32)*0.01+1,IIF([A]<=8,Convert(([A]-5)*2,System.Int32)*0.02+1.1,Convert(([A]-8)*2,System.Int32)*0.03+1.22))))

 回到顶部
帅哥哟,离线,有人找我吗?
jjyou
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:18 积分:312 威望:0 精华:0 注册:2010/3/6 17:00:00
  发帖心情 Post By:2010/3/20 13:52:00 [只看该作者]

A列可以是小数,A列只取值到10就行了,不能为负数

 回到顶部
帅哥哟,离线,有人找我吗?
jjyou
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:18 积分:312 威望:0 精华:0 注册:2010/3/6 17:00:00
  发帖心情 Post By:2010/3/20 13:55:00 [只看该作者]

这个公式在易表里用刷新公式很容易解决,不知在FOXTABLE里怎么写

 回到顶部
帅哥哟,离线,有人找我吗?
jjyou
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:18 积分:312 威望:0 精华:0 注册:2010/3/6 17:00:00
  发帖心情 Post By:2010/3/20 14:07:00 [只看该作者]

谢谢lxl,问题已解决

 回到顶部